TerraCap is a fast-growing, entrepreneurial private equity real estate investment firm with approximately $2 billion in assets under management. The firm recently launched a $500 million value-add fund focused on acquiring underperforming commercial and residential assets across high-growth markets in the Sunbelt region. This is a rare opportunity to join a vertically integrated platform backed by a seasoned leadership team with a proven track record of delivering risk-adjusted returns above industry benchmarks. With a hands-on investment philosophy and a commitment to long-term value creation, the firm is well positioned for continued growth.Reporting to the National Director of Acquisitions, this individual will support sourcing, analyzing, and executing investment opportunities across multiple property types"”including residential, industrial, and select niche assets"”with the goal of generating mid-teens IRRs or better. The role will also have meaningful exposure to capital markets execution, portfolio analytics, and fund-level strategy, serving as a critical contributor across the full lifecycle of the firm's investments.CLIENT DESCRIPTION:TerraCap Management is a 100% employee owned, commercial real estate investment manager focused on value-add real estate acquisitions in the South Atlantic, West Central South, and West Mountain regions of the U.S. They have been in operation since 2008 with offices located in Naples, FL, Tampa, FL, Denver, CO, and soon the Austin, TX metro area. TerraCap currently has approximately $2 billion in assets under management and the principals aim to diversify the firm's real estate portfolio across several asset classes including multifamily, industrial, and office.
